A Journey Centuries in the Making
Stretching over 2,000 kilometres across the breathtaking landscape of Saudi Arabia, the Incense Route is one of the ancient world’s most celebrated corridors — a network of trade paths that once carried frankincense, myrrh, and the cultural exchange of civilisations between the Arabian Peninsula and the Mediterranean. Traversed by merchants, explorers, and wanderers across thousands of years, the route stands today as a UNESCO World Heritage Site and one of the most evocative trails on the planet.
Rosie Stancer, one of Britain’s most decorated polar and endurance explorers, chose this extraordinary route as the setting for her most ambitious expedition to date — leading an all-female team on a full crossing of the Incense Route on foot, covering up to 30 kilometres per day through soaring temperatures, shifting sands, and terrain that tested every limit of human endurance.
